蜜桃传媒深度体验报告:卡顿、延迟、无法访问时的排查路径(功能剖析版)

-
体验背景与目标 在数字内容分发越来越依赖实时性与可用性的大环境下,蜜桃传媒的用户体验很大程度上依赖于系统各环节的协同表现。本报告聚焦在“卡顿、延迟、无法访问”等典型问题的排查路径,并从功能角度对关键模块进行深度剖析,旨在帮助技术团队快速定位问题源头、明确责任链条、并给出落地的优化方案。内容覆盖前端、网络传输、后端应用、数据存储与分发网络等核心环节,辅以实操清单与案例分析,便于在真实环境中直接应用。
-
问题分类与影响
- 卡顿(页面/播放器响应慢、操作滞后):影响用户交互体验,可能来自前端渲染、资源加载、网络抖动或后端接口阻塞。
- 延迟(首屏时间长、资源加载慢、视频/音频缓冲):往往与网络传输、CDN命中、服务器处理时间以及前端渲染挂起有关。
- 无法访问(请求超时、域名解析失败、边缘节点不可用):可能涉及域名解析、DNS、CDN、边缘节点故障、证书问题、服务端不可用或限流策略。
- 影響清单(优先级排序):1) 核心功能的可用性(是否能加载页面/播放器) 2) 关键操作的响应时间(搜索、播放、点赞等) 3) 用户在高峰期的体验稳定性 4) 针对不同地区的可用性差异
- 排查框架概览 将问题分解为四大维度,形成可操作的排查框架:
- 网络与传输层:连接建立、握手、传输时延、丢包、带宽波动、CDN命中情况。
- 应用层与后端:接口响应时间、错误率、并发容量、服务依赖关系、限流策略。
- 客户端渲染与资源加载:HTML/CSS/JavaScript的加载与执行、渲染阻塞、资源体积、缓存策略。
- 数据与分发基础设施:缓存命中率、数据库慢查询、队列与异步任务的处理、边缘节点健康状况。
- 功能剖析:关键模块与指标 4.1 客户端与网络栈
- 指标要点:首屏时间、交互就绪时间、渲染帧率、资源加载顺序、最大并发请求数、DNS解析时间、TCP/TLS握手时间、网络抖动。
- 常见问题源头:资源体积过大、脚本阻塞、第三方脚本影响、加密握手延迟、浏览器兼容性问题。
- 排查要点:借助浏览器开发者工具的Network和Performance面板,关注资源加载时间、阻塞时间、脚本执行时间、GC事件。
4.2 网络传输与CDN
- 指标要点:终端到边缘节点的往返时间、CDN缓存命中率、边缘节点可用性、TLS证书有效性、带宽抖动、丢包率。
- 常见问题源头:CDN缓存未命中、边缘节点故障、域名解析异常、DNS分配波动、跨区域回源瓶颈。
- 排查要点:对比不同地域的访问数据,检查DNS分发策略、CDN命中日志、TLS握手耗时、实时监控的流量来源。
4.3 服务器端应用与接口
- 指标要点:接口平均响应时间(TTFB、TTI)、错误率、并发请求数、后端服务链路的延迟分布、数据库慢查询、队列长度。
- 常见问题源头:单点瓶颈、长尾请求导致的资源竞争、外部依赖的延迟、限流策略触发、服务端缓存失效。
- 排查要点:对微服务链路进行分布式追踪,分析热点接口的延迟分布与错误类型,查看资源池(连接、线程、队列)的健康状况。
4.4 数据层与存储
- 指标要点:数据库读写延迟、缓存命中率、缓存回源时间、日志聚合延迟、异步任务执行时延。
- 常见问题源头:慢查询、连接池耗尽、缓存穿透/击穿、回源压力、数据同步延迟。
- 排查要点:用慢查询日志、缓存命中/失效统计、队列堆积情况进行定位,关注数据一致性与同步策略。
4.5 内容分发与缓存策略
- 指标要点:静态资源缓存时间、动态资源的缓存策略、边缘节点数量与健康度、版本回滚时间窗。
- 常见问题源头:资源版本未命中缓存、缓存失效策略设计不当、回源重试导致延迟累积。
- 排查要点:检查缓存键设计、Cache-Control/ETag策略、CDN刷新时间、回源策略与容错机制。
- 实测工具与数据采集 5.1 常用工具清单
- 浏览器开发者工具:Network、Performance、Console。
- 专业工具:WebPageTest、Lighthouse、PAGE SPEED Insights、Web Vitals工具。
- 网络与链路工具:ping、traceroute/mtr、nslookup/dig、curl -I、ss、iftop或nload。
- 服务端与监控:Prometheus/Grafana、New Relic、Datadog、Zipkin/Jaeger等分布式追踪工具。
- 负载与压力测试:k6、Locust、JMeter。
- 日志与告警:ELK/EFK、Fluentd、Grafana Loki、PagerDuty等。
5.2 指标定义与阈值(参考,具体以蜜桃传媒现状为准)
- 首屏加载时间(Time to First Byte TTFB、Time to Interactive TTI):目标在用户感知可用的时间内,TTFB尽可能低,TTI在2-5秒之间为理想区间(页面结构清晰、交互就绪)。
- 总体可用性:在指定时间段内,用户能正常加载页面并进行核心操作的比例,目标通常≥99.9%。
- 延迟分布:95th/99th/99.9th百分位延迟,重点关注高尾部延迟的优化。
- 资源加载时间:关键资源(JS、CSS、视频/音频)的加载总耗时与阻塞时间。
- 错误率:请求失败、网络超时、DNS解析失败等错误的发生率。
- CDN命中率与回源时间:命中率越高、回源时间越短,用户体验越稳定。
- 慢查询比例:数据库慢查询占比、平均响应时间。
- 可执行排查步骤清单(分阶段) 阶段A:再现与基线
- 收集出现场景:地域、设备类型、网络条件、时间段、是否高峰期。
- 重现问题:在可控环境中复现卡顿、延迟或无法访问的具体场景,记录时间线和影响范围。
- 建立基线数据:在无问题时段采集相同指标,作为对比基线。
阶段B:网络与传输诊断
- 检查DNS解析时间与命中情况,确认DNS是否稳定。
- 测试到边缘节点的往返时延及丢包,分析是否存在抖动过大。
- 验证TLS握手与建立连接的耗时,排查证书或握手带来的额外延迟。
- 评估CDN命中率、边缘节点健康度,以及回源路径的延迟。
阶段C:后端与接口诊断
- 对热点接口进行分布式追踪,查看TTFB、TTI、错误类型和并发压力。
- 检查后端服务的资源池(连接、线程、队列)状态,定位阻塞点。
- 检查外部依赖(第三方API、数据库、消息队列)的响应时间与错误率。
阶段D:前端与资源加载诊断
- 使用Performance/Network分析资源加载顺序、阻塞时间、脚本执行时间。
- 优化渲染阻塞资源,评估懒加载、代码拆分、按需加载的效果。
- 检查缓存策略、资源版本、跨域资源加载等影响加载速度的因素。
阶段E:数据与分发层诊断
- 查看缓存命中率、回源时间、数据库慢查询及异步任务时延。
- 审核缓存穿透/击穿风险点,确保合理的缓存设计和回源策略。
阶段F:验证与回归

- 针对定位的原因,实施修复或回退策略,重新测试直至达到基线或改进目标。
- 进行回归验证,确保修复不会引入新问题,记录变更日志。
- 典型问题清单与对策
- 情景1:首屏拉取大量未压缩资源,导致渲染阻塞 对策:资源分拆、按需加载、启用gzip/Brotli、提前执行关键CSS/JS、减少第三方脚本依赖。
- 情景2:CDN命中率低且回源时间长 对策:优化资源版本控制、调整缓存策略、增加边缘节点、提高静态资源的TTL、合理的回源重试策略。
- 情景3:后端接口在高并发时响应缓慢 对策:服务端限流与熔断、升级后端容量、数据库优化(索引、连接池)、异步处理关键路径。
- 情景4:跨区域访问时网络抖动导致播放中断 对策:加强多区域的CDN分发、实现更鲁棒的多源加载、引入自适应比特率与缓冲策略。
- 情景5:慢查询与数据库瓶颈 对策:分析慢查询、优化索引、分库分表、缓存热点数据、异步写入与批量处理。
- 功能剖析深度案例(虚构示例,供参考) 案例背景:蜜桃传媒在A区域用户群体中遇到播放器卡顿与间歇性加载失败的问题,且在中高峰时段显著增加。
- 客户端端:Performance数据显示首屏渲染时间从1.8秒提升至4.5秒,阻塞资源集中在主JS文件与视频预加载脚本。
- 网络端:到边缘节点的平均往返时间增加,CDN缓存命中率下降,回源时间增大。
- 后端端:核心播放器API在并发高峰时响应时间上升,错误率略有波动,但无显著崩溃。
- 数据层:缓存命中率下降,数据库对热点视频元数据查询响应变慢。
- 处理策略:对前端进行代码拆分、关键脚本按需加载、提升CDN缓存策略、优化后端接口、加强缓存与数据库查询的并发能力、增加边缘节点覆盖与回源策略。结果:在同一时段,平均播放起始时间下降约40%,首屏渲染时间回到2.0-2.5秒区间,整体可用性提升显著。
- 优化建议与最佳实践(可直接落地)
- 资源优化:静态资源进行gzip/Brotli压缩、分段加载、关键资源优先加载、图片/视频的自适应格式与尺寸。
- 渠道与分发:加强CDN策略与命中率,合理设定缓存TTL,确保版本控制与回滚机制稳健。
- 前端性能:采用代码拆分、懒加载、浏览器缓存策略、减少阻塞渲染的脚本执行时间。
- 后端架构:对热点接口进行容量规划、分布式追踪定位瓶颈、应用层与存储层的并发管理、引入异步处理与缓存机制。
- 数据与存储:优化数据库索引、缩短慢查询路径、提升缓存命中率、确保数据同步的时效性。
- 监控与自动化:建立端到端的监控仪表盘、设定阈值告警、实施可观测性驱动的迭代优化。
-
结论 通过对蜜桃传媒在卡顿、延迟、无法访问等问题的功能剖析与系统化排查,本报告提供了一套可操作的诊断框架与落地方案。无论是网络传输、后端服务、还是前端渲染与缓存策略,每一个环节都可能成为影响用户体验的关键因素。将上述排查路径变成常态化的运维流程,能够在问题初现端就快速定位、精准修复,并持续提升系统的稳定性与用户感知的响应性。
-
作者简介与联系 我是专注于自我推广与技术落地相结合的创作者,长期从事数字内容分发、网络与应用性能优化领域的实战写作与咨询工作。通过结合行业案例与可执行的诊断步骤,帮助团队把复杂的技术问题拆解成可执行的改进计划。如果你需要我为你的项目定制系统级的性能优化方案、排查手册或技术文稿,欢迎联系我。邮箱/联系方式可在个人网站的联系页获取,期待与你的团队一起把用户体验推向新高度。